site stats

Syntax of cte in sql

WebJul 6, 2024 · In this case all fields in the SELECT list should be assigned to a variable! Or you can assign a single row-single column SELECT statement's result to a variable by the SET keyword: SET @YourVariable = (SELECT COUNT (1) FROM YourTable). You can not mix the above options. Furthermore, CTE is defined within the execution scope of a single SELECT … WebUse a CTE in a query. You can use a common table expression (CTE) to simplify creating a view or table, selecting data, or inserting data. Use a CTE to create a table based on another table that you select using the CREATE TABLE AS SELECT (CTAS) clause. CREATE TABLE s2 AS WITH q1 AS (SELECT key FROM src WHERE key = '4') SELECT * FROM q1;

How to use CTEs in SQL - Towards Data Science

WebSep 26, 2024 · The syntax for writing a Common Table Expression in Oracle or SQL Server using the SQL WITH clause is: WITH cte_name [ (column_aliases)] AS ( … WebJun 24, 2024 · MySQL CTE Syntax. cte_name – It is the name of the CTE for further use. column_list – names of columns. It is optional. However, the column_list must be the … easy homemade family recipes https://ramsyscom.com

The WITH clause and common table expressions (CTEs) [YSQL]

W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ax below is an example of how this would work. ;WITH cte_HighestSales AS ( SELECT ROW_NUMBER() OVER (PARTITION BY FirstTableId ORDER BY Amount DESC) AS … WebMar 1, 2024 · AS. (--normal SQl query. SELECT *. FROM table) In the code above, the CTE must start with a WITH. This tells your query that it is a CTE statement. Next, CTE_NAME … WebFor an example of an insert with common table expressions, in the below query, we see an insert occur to the table, reportOldestAlmondAverages, with the table being created … easy homemade hawaiian rolls

sql - When to use Common Table Expression (CTE)

Category:How to Remove Duplicate Records in SQL - Database Star

Tags:Syntax of cte in sql

Syntax of cte in sql

Inserts and Updates with CTEs in SQL Server (Common Table

WebSummary: in this tutorial, you will learn how to use the SQL Server recursive CTE to query hierarchical data.. Introduction to SQL Server recursive CTE. A recursive common table … WebCommon table expressions (CTEs) are a great way to break up complex queries. MySQL started supporting this in version 8. Here's a simple query to illustrate how to write a CTE: …

Syntax of cte in sql

Did you know?

WebTo specify common table expressions, use a WITH clause that has one or more comma-separated subclauses. Each subclause provides a subquery that produces a result set, … WebThe following shows the syntax of creating a CTE: WITH cte_name (column_list) AS ( CTE_query_definition ) statement; Code language: PHP (php) In this syntax: First, specify …

WebI have also seen significant performance difference between CTE and TEMP table while working with large dataset in databricks. ... There is a difference is learning SQL syntax and the knowledge you gain from solving problems. -_- Advices are generic because those are the advices which make sense. WebThe two queries will have the pursuing consequence set: 2. Select, INSERT, UPDATE, DELETE, or MERGE Follows a SQL CTE. The previous SQL CTE examples you observed …

WebIn this syntax: First, specify the name of the CTE. Later, you can refer to the common table expression name in the SQL statement. Next, specify a list of comma-separated columns … WebMay 24, 2024 · Driver version mssql-jdbc-8.2.2.jre8.jar SQL Server version SQL Server 2016 Client Operating System Windows 10 64 bit JAVA/JVM version Java 8 Table schema NA Problem description I am unable to submit a WITH CTE in a SQL Query via JDBC wh...

WebA Common Table Expression (CTE) is a named result set in a SQL query. CTEs help keep your code organized, and allow you to perform multi-level aggregations on your data, like finding the average of a set of counts. We’ll walk through some examples to show you how CTEs work and why you would use them, using the Sample Database included with …

WebSQL Server CTE. The SQL Server CTE, also called Common Table Expressions used to generate a temporary named set (like a temporary table) that exists for the duration of a … easy homemade fajita seasoning recipeWebMar 6, 2024 · With CTE, we can break a long query into smaller parts making it simpler to understand and readable, and also supporting recursive implementation where traversal … easy homemade hard rolls tmhWebJan 19, 2024 · The common table expression (CTE) is a powerful construct in SQL that helps simplify a query. CTEs work as virtual tables (with records and columns), created during the execution of a query, used by the query, and eliminated after query execution. CTEs often act as a bridge to transform the data in source tables to the format expected by the query. easy homemade egyptian kebabs recipeWebSQL : How to fix "near 'with': syntax error" in recursive CTE query (flask/sqlalchemy)To Access My Live Chat Page, On Google, Search for "hows tech developer... easy homemade flaky pie crust with butterWebJun 7, 2024 · Structure of CTE in SQL (Image credits: MariaDB) WITH expression_name_1 AS (CTE query definition 1) [, expression_name_X AS (CTE query definition X), etc ] … easy homemade foot soakWebOct 29, 2010 · October 29, 2010. Greg Larsen explores using multiple Common Table Expressions (CTEs), the MAXRECUSION option, how to use a CTE within a cursor, and what you cannot do within a CTE. I introduced you to Common Table Expression (CTE) in my last article. In that article, I covered the basic syntax of a CTE and provided a couple of … easy homemade french onion dipWebCode language: SQL (Structured Query Language) (sql) A recursive CTE has three elements: Non-recursive term: the non-recursive term is a CTE query definition that forms the base result set of the CTE structure. Recursive term: the recursive term is one or more CTE query definitions joined with the non-recursive term using the UNION or UNION ALL ... easy homemade dog treats pumpkin